The Marleth query service shipped a planner regression in v4.2 that can cause certain filtered exports to time out. Support can confirm whether a customer is affected by calling the internal diagnostics endpoint, which returns the chosen plan for a given query hash. The endpoint is read-only and safe to call on production tenants. Authenticate your diagnostics requests with the service key below.

gateway credential: kto3_qfe

**Action Item RM-07: Eliminate clock skew across Dunmore build agents**

Skew of up to ninety seconds between agents caused artifact timestamps to appear out of order, breaking release provenance checks. We will deploy a unified time-sync daemon and add a pre-build skew gate. Rollout schedule, agent inventory, and verification steps are maintained on the internal page.

wiki page, tahaf-tajog: https://jira.ordindyn.corp/pipeline

Subject: Handover — Junkdrawer queue swap

Hey Marisol,

Quick handover before I log off. We're mid-migration from our homegrown Junkdrawer queue to the new Relaywise broker, and plugin authors are going to feel it. The old enqueue API still works behind a shim, but retries now come from Relaywise, so duplicate-delivery behavior changed. Watch for plugin bug reports about jobs firing twice; tag them "queue-swap" so we can batch the fixes.

Any external authors who hit weirdness should write to us directly.

escalation mailbox, bafog-fafog: ulador@paliqlabs.internal